Friendship, Wisconsin

Friendship, Wisconsin is 64 miles W of Oshkosh, Wisconsin (center to center) and 116 miles NW of Milwaukee, Wisconsin. It is in Adams county. The population of the village is 698.

The People and Families of Friendship

In Friendship, about 43% of adults are married. Adults in Friendship are more likely than in most places to live alone. There are a lot of singles in the village.

It's notable that men are disproportionately common in Friendship. Seniors are common in the village.

Wealth and Education

In 2000, Friendship had a median family income of $33,438.

Political Inclinations

Among Friendship political contributors, John Kerry was favored among Presidential candidates in 2004, with $500. The Republican party attracted the largest share of donations from the village.

Friendship Housing

Of the housing in Friendship, approximately 59% is occupied by their owners. A good bit of the housing in the village is used seasonally or for leisure or vacation purposes. Property taxes in Friendship are low by Wisconsin standards.

Commuting

In Friendship, 88% of commuters drive to work. The layout of the village makes walking and bicycling easier than most places. Friendship features shorter commuting times than most similar places.
